yealink uses two URBs that submit each other. This arrangement cannot
be reliably killed with usb_kill_urb() alone, as there's a window
during which the wrong URB may be killed. The fix is to introduce a
flag.

Skype is unreliable whenever the device is connected.  The system
will eventually freeze completely.  No magic key; resetting the
computer is not enough to get it rebooted.  One have to power it
down.
